The Health Information Technology for Clinical and Economic Health (HITECH) Act, part of the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act of 2009, gave State Attorneys General (State AGs) the authority to bring civil actions on behalf of state residents for violations of the HIPAA Privacy and Security Rules.

VAPAC is the state political action committee that collects funds from the general membership for distribution to candidates who have a proven interest in and support for insurance legislation. It studies voting records and accepts contribution recommendations from the Legislative Committee.
